A truck windshield is not only a safety device, but it is also critical for maintaining the structural integrity of a vehicle. It also plays a crucial role in supporting the numerous sensors that are embedded within modern vehicle systems. As such, it is vital to recognize when damage may occur so that the proper steps can be taken to protect a truck from further harm.
In some cases, even the smallest of cracks in a windshield can result in significant damage. Taking your truck to an experienced technician early on can save you money, time and stress in the long run. This is especially important because the longer you wait, the more difficult it will be to repair.
Often, the most common causes of cracked windshields are natural wear and tear or damage from airborne debris. Cracks can also form from the pressure of road accidents and sudden changes in temperature, as well as the impact of wind or hail storms. A damaged windshield can be a serious hazard on the road, impairing your vision and making it hard to see other vehicles and pedestrians. Moreover, it can be very dangerous for truck drivers who rely on unobstructed visibility to maintain a high level of safety.
If you suspect that your truck windshield is damaged, it is important to seek professional help as soon as possible. In many jurisdictions, driving with a faulty windshield is against the law and can lead to heavy fines. In addition, ignoring the issue may decrease the resale value of your truck in the future. Prospective buyers will view the windshield as a sign of neglect, and this can make it harder for you to sell or trade your vehicle.
Once it has been determined that a replacement is necessary, technicians will carefully remove the old windshield. The new windshield will then be installed, and the technicians ensure that it is aligned with the frame of the truck and any sensors or cameras. Once the installation is complete, the technicians will apply a protective seal around the edges of the windshield.
